What is Coin360 co exactly?
Coin360 co is a data aggregation platform that consolidates live prices, market depth, and liquidity visuals across multiple crypto exchanges to aid price discovery and market analysis.
How reliable is the data from Coin360 co?
Reliability hinges on source diversity and reconciliation mechanisms; Coin360 co typically corroborates prices across several major venues to reduce latency and data gaps, though traders should verify with primary exchange feeds during high-volatility events.
Can Coin360 co help with arbitrage strategies?
Yes, by showing best bid/ask spreads and cross-exchange price differentials in real time, Coin360 co can illuminate potential arbitrage opportunities, provided execution costs are factored in.
Does Coin360 co provide regulatory updates?
Coin360 co primarily focuses on price and market data; regulatory news is usually sourced from accompanying analytics, but direct regulatory dashboards are not its core offering.
How should I incorporate Coin360 co into my workflow?
Treat Coin360 co as a real-time dashboard for cross-exchange price discovery, supplementing it with on-chain analytics, sentiment data, and official exchange notices to form a holistic view before trading decisions.
What are common limitations to watch for?
Latency disparities between exchanges, data-feed outages, and time-zone synchronization issues can affect accuracy; always corroborate with multiple feeds during sharp market moves.
